Will take public view on H-4 spouse visa: Trump administration

WASHINGTON: The Trump administration has assured lawmakers and the American corporate sector that people would get an opportunity to respond to its proposal of revoking work authorisation to

H-4 spouse visas

after they raised their concerns over the move, which will impact thousands of Indians. H-4 visas are issued to the spouses of H-1B foreign workers.


The Department of Homeland Security had said that the US Citizenship and

Immigration

Services (

USCIS

) will come out with a new proposal by January 2019 under which it is mulling to remove from its regulations certain H-4 spouses of H-1B non-immigrants as a class of aliens eligible for employment authorisation.

The new rules could impact up to 70,000 H-4 Visa holders who have work permits. The USCIS has written to US lawmakers and leaders of the corporate sector who had raised concern over the Trump administration’s proposal to revoke the H-4 visas.
